TedX Portland Brand Identity
— I worked on a team that created the branding for the first TedX Portland event in 2011. The event’s producers came to us with the theme “crossroads” and thus XRD mark was born.

We wanted to create a special moment when speakers received their invitation for the event. We also wanted to reinforce the concept of using intersecting lines to create a “visual crossroad.” The result was a lenticular-based invitation that created an analog animation as the card is pulled from its outer sleeve. Our main goal throughout this project was to create an experience that went beyond just logo applications. The adaptability and versatility of the lenticular aesthetic we developed allowed us to easily translate it into different mediums ranging from print to interactive and motion design.

TedX Portland Website

— A few of W+K Studio’s digital designers helped us to translate our lenticular aesthetic of the print collateral to the website by using a parallax technique. As the user scrolls down the page, they are able to break apart the XRD logotype in a manner that reflects the treatment and movement of rest of the identity, and it eventually transforms into PDX.
